2022 GHS to UZS Historical Review
A comprehensive breakdown of exchange rate performance throughout the year 2022.
2022 GHS to UZS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2022
During 2022, the GHS to UZS ex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 3, valuing the pair at 1761.7167.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on November 21, dropping to 768.0548.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 993.6619 UZS.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 1741.8163 to the December average rate of 1061.0729, the exchange rate registered a net change of -39.08% (reflecting a weakening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2022 high of 1761.7167 was down 4.07% compared to the 2021 peak of 1836.5307,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

GHS to UZS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is
A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.
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)
SeasonalThe average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 1549.0732, compared to 1064.6918 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 484.3815 points.
Volatility Range Comparison
VolatilityThe most volatile month in 2022 was December, with a trading range of 557.6064 UZS (High: 1354.1199 / Low: 796.5135). On the other end, November was the most stable month, with a tight range of 43.3087 UZS (High: 811.3635 / Low: 768.0548).
Growth Streaks & Declines
TrendsNo sustained consecutive month-over-month growth streak of 2+ months occurred in 2022.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between October and November, when the average rate fell by 166.1868 points.
Same-Month Historical Baseline
YoY BaselineComparing the current year's strongest month average (January 2022: 1741.8163) against the same month in 2021 (average: 1791.2167), the exchange rate shifted by -49.4004 (-2.76%).
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 1761.7167 | 1717.1557 | 1741.8163 |
| February | 1713.9393 | 1597.7941 | 1667.1751 |
| March | 1594.3407 | 1493.1780 | 1547.3410 |
| April | 1524.1611 | 1480.1325 | 1501.6940 |
| May | 1499.4584 | 1409.6605 | 1454.9310 |
| June | 1412.1795 | 1346.4487 | 1381.4821 |
| July | 1356.6030 | 1288.3568 | 1338.3468 |
| August | 1292.8747 | 1087.6300 | 1175.7698 |
| September | 1103.4390 | 1054.0670 | 1085.9688 |
| October | 1067.5352 | 795.0552 | 946.5896 |
| November | 811.3635 | 768.0548 | 780.4027 |
| December | 1354.1199 | 796.5135 | 1061.0729 |
